1990 325i 324,000kms. It is up on jack stands and I want to test my rear bushings. How do I do it?

should be obvius if there dead or not. take the covers of the bottom and you will se if the rubbers cracked or the centre part is detached

Support the rear of the car on the body and jack/lever the rear beam upwards near the ends. If there's any movement, rather than just slight flexing of rubber, then the bushes are shot.
